Searched refs:SnoopFilter (Results 1 - 5 of 5) sorted by relevance

/gem5/src/mem/
H A Dsnoop_filter.cc49 #include "debug/SnoopFilter.hh"
52 const int SnoopFilter::SNOOP_MASK_SIZE;
55 SnoopFilter::eraseIfNullEntry(SnoopFilterCache::iterator& sf_it)
60 DPRINTF(SnoopFilter, "%s: Removed SF entry.\n",
65 std::pair<SnoopFilter::SnoopList, Cycles>
66 SnoopFilter::lookupRequest(const Packet* cpkt, const SlavePort& slave_port)
68 DPRINTF(SnoopFilter, "%s: src %s packet %s\n", __func__,
109 DPRINTF(SnoopFilter, "%s: SF value %x.%x\n",
126 DPRINTF(SnoopFilter, "%s: new SF value %x.%x\n",
135 DPRINTF(SnoopFilter,
[all...]
H A DXBar.py102 snoop_filter = Param.SnoopFilter(NULL, "Selected snoop filter")
122 class SnoopFilter(SimObject): class in inherits:SimObject
123 type = 'SnoopFilter'
151 snoop_filter = SnoopFilter(lookup_latency = 0)
173 snoop_filter = SnoopFilter(lookup_latency = 1)
H A Dsnoop_filter.hh55 #include "params/SnoopFilter.hh"
88 class SnoopFilter : public SimObject { class in inherits:SimObject
96 SnoopFilter (const SnoopFilterParams *p) : function in class:SnoopFilter
324 inline SnoopFilter::SnoopMask
325 SnoopFilter::portToMask(const SlavePort& port) const
333 inline SnoopFilter::SnoopList
334 SnoopFilter::maskToPortList(SnoopMask port_mask) const
H A Dcoherent_xbar.hh279 SnoopFilter *snoopFilter;
/gem5/tests/configs/
H A Dmemtest-filter.py41 membus = SystemXBar(width=16, snoop_filter = SnoopFilter()))
53 snoop_filter = SnoopFilter())

Completed in 10 milliseconds